Hi: I was operated on for staage 4 ovarian cancer in 2003.  I had debulking surgery and then 6 sessions of chemo with taxeter and carboplatin.  I successfully got the CA 125 down below 35 for over three years.  Last year theCA 125 started to rise and I had a catscan to show the cancer was back.  This time I had 5 sessions of chemo and go single digit readings CA125 of 6.  This Oct my CA 125 had risen again to 29 this time and I will see the oncologist in Nov. for another blood test.  I take supplements, but it is a slippery slope. I seems to rule my life and I don't make any plans ahead of 3 months.  The chemo was very debilerating, an d I had dry eyes and neuropathy in fingers and toes.  I feel fine now and am hoping for the best next month.  The oncologist said I now have a chronic condition and will have to be maintained with the cancer, but I don't know how long this will go on.  Hope this is of some help
